A very unique book surprisingly grounded for Mieville.
I almost feel like there is a bit of a bait and switch going on here. Hearing about this book and having read some Mieville I expected this to be very "out there" and abstract. Instead I found a very grounded book, that you could argue is a straight up detective novel without any real science fiction elements.
As a detective novel it's quote a good read, although a little bloated in the middle, I felt it finished off quite nicely. It also does ...more
